Transaction 34c50c501fb4348a6073ab53c330bd13e5e1757de3eb99652ca9bd3f7a82ca3f

25 Input
2 Outputs
  • 34c50c501fb4348a6073ab53c330bd13e5e1757de3eb99652ca9bd3f7a82ca3f:0
  • value  265595579
    address  35vXKTPurbS7b9BhhZvEw9n95ShEYZ12Sm
  • 34c50c501fb4348a6073ab53c330bd13e5e1757de3eb99652ca9bd3f7a82ca3f:1
  • value  1286246248
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r